Future Value (FV): What Is It?

Future value is the value of a current asset at some point in the future based on an assumed rate of growth (FV). The future value is important to investors and financial planners because they use it to estimate how much an investment made today will be worth in the future. Knowing the future value enables investors to choose wisely based on their anticipated needs.

However, external economic factors that depreciate an asset's value, like inflation, can have a negative impact on the asset's future value. One can compare present value to future value (PV). The FV equation is as follows if an investment earns simple interest:

[tex]FV=I*[1+(R*T)][/tex]

where,

Investment sum, I

Interest rate = R

T is the number of years.

What is Predetermined overhead rate?

The estimated cost of manufacturing overhead is applied to cost objects for a particular reporting period using an allocation rate called a predetermined overhead rate. Since this rate does not require the compilation of actual manufacturing overhead costs as part of the period-end closing process, it is frequently used to help close the books more quickly. But at the very least at the conclusion of each fiscal year, the discrepancy between the amounts of overhead that were estimated and actual must be reconciled.

What is a call option?

A call option is a derivative option that gives the holder of the call option the right and not the obligation to buy an asset at a predetermined price known as the strike price. The call option would be exercised if the current price of the asset is higher than the strike price.

For example assume that the exchange rate of the CAD and the US dollar is 0.80 CAD to 1 dollar. Assume that it is expected that the CAD would appreciate in value inn the future. A US investor could decide to buy a call option with a strike price of 0.85 CAD to 1 dollar. Assume that at the time of the expiration of the call option, the exchange rate is 0.90 CAD to 1 dollar. The US firm would exercise the call option and exchange the currency at 0.85 CAD to 1 dollar.

What is Promissory estoppel?

Generally, It is a concept of law that forbids one person from breaking their promise to another and unjustly inflicting harm to another individual as a result of their actions.

In the event that legal action is taken, the court has the authority to prevent (or estop) a person from breaking a commitment that they have given to another party.

In conclusion, the law of promissory estoppel is one that the courts may use to estop or prohibit, John from withdrawing his promise.

a group organized for purposes other than generating profit and in which no part of the organization's income is distributed to its members, directors, or officers.

Not-for-profit is a broad term for organizations that do not generate profit for their owners. All money generated by the not-for-profit business must be reinvested back into running it. Unlike nonprofits, not-for-profits are not required to operate specifically for the benefit of the public or the advancement of a social cause. A not-for-profit can simply operate to serve the goals or special interests of its members. For example, recreational sports clubs can operate as a not-for-profit.

What is a Roth IRA?

A Roth IRA can be defined as an individual retirement account that avail the holders tax-free growths and tax-free withdrawals based on the satisfaction of certain conditions.

What is 401(k)?

A 401(k) can be defined as a type of savings plan that is sponsored by a business firm (employer), so as to avail its employees an opportunity to contribute a certain amount of money into on a regular basis.
